                In fact, if you keep your watch always under water there is no way for the GPS signal to reach it.

                    yes, but that’s the same for every watch.
                    satellite signals do not enter the water at all. no chance to calculate your position when the watch is submerged only a tiny little bit

                        what you could do, if you prefer breaststroke, get an inflatable safety buoy with a small wallet compartment and put the watch in there. of course you need external HR and stroke will not be counted, but distance will be correct. downside: you can’t see your time and distance during the activity.
                        alternatively put the phone in there and track with SA?
